A Disabled Artist Paints Beautiful Fairies Using Her iPad

According to Monica Michelle: “Before I was disabled I was a photographer now I paint using my iPad. I have many toys to deal with chronic pain but distraction by art is a favorite of mine. For five years I have been working on fairy illustrations.”
